Philip Caveney (AKA Danny Weston) is a British Y/A author, best known for the Sebastian Darke, Alec Devlin and Movie Maniacs novels. He previously wrote a number of thrillers for adults under the name Philip Caveney.
This event is for both Y/A readers and writers a well as adults.
